Be a part of sharing special places and shaping lasting memories with Australias leading experiential tourism business.About UsCruise Whitsundays, based in Airlie Beach is the largest marine-based tour and transport provider in the Whitsundays. Providing close encounters with the Great Barrier Reef, Whitehaven Beach, and the islands of the Whitsundays, Cruise Whitsundays operates 10, well-equipped, air-conditioned vessels, plus a world-class sailing catamaran, offering a range of tours, as well as an inter-island resort connection service, with regular daily departures at two islands, one airport and two mainland ports.Cruise Whitsundays also operates Australias first underwater accommodation, Reefsuites, and a Reefsleep glamping experience at the Reefworld pontoon, moored offshore at Hardy Reef on the Great Barrier Reef.From our cruises and sailing adventures to our world-renowned underwater accommodation, theres no better way to experience the Whitsundays, and you wont find a friendlier or more experienced crew to work with.
